Sign In — Free (10 views/day)Southern California Immigration Project, founded in 2015, is a community nonprofit in the International Affairs sector that reported $1.0M in total revenue in fiscal year 2025. Revenue grew 14% year-over-year, indicating healthy expansion. The organization ran a surplus of $242K, a strong 24% operating margin.
Southern California Immigration Project is a public interest nonprofit organization dedicated to providing pro bono legal services to survivors of human and civil rights violations.
